A role for triglyceride lipase brummer in the regulation of sex differences in Drosophila fat storage and breakdown.

Triglycerides are the major form of stored fat in all animals. One important determinant of whole-body fat storage is whether an animal is male or female. Here, we use Drosophila, an established model for studies on triglyceride metabolism, to gain insight into the genes and physiological mechanisms...
